TIP#1449: Co je to bookmarklet a jak se to používá

S termínem bookmarklet (někdy též favelet) se nebudete asi setkávat příliš často. Umí to ale být užitečná pomůcka – využívá existenci „bookmarků“, tedy možnosti ukládat si odkazy mezi Oblíbené do prohlížeče. Ty asi znáte a používáte (nebo byste alespoň měli).

Bookmarklet využívá toho, že do Oblíbených/Favorites je možné uložit javascript, tedy kód co se spustí po kliknutí (vyvolání) dané položky. Vždy se spouští na určitou stránku, která je pro něj zdrojem dat. Stejný javascript můžete psát i do adresního řádku prohlížeče – nebo tedy spíše mohli jste, dnes většina prohlížečů něco takového (z bezpečnostních důvodů) znemožní (musíte využít vývojářské pomůcky a Konzoli přes Ctrl+Shift+J v Chrom, Ctrl+Shift+K ve Firefoxu)

Z Oblíbených (a tedy z „bookmarkletu“) to ale půjde pořád snadno – stačí když si potřebný kód uložíte mezi oblíbené – můžete to udělat ručně (založíte si novou položku v Oblíbených, pojmenujete ji a místo URL vložíte kód). Případně, pokud máte někde na Internetu nějaký připravený bookmarklet, tak prostě pomocí Drag&Drop přetáhněte onen bookmarklet (bude to odkaz na stránce) mezi Oblíbené (Edge tohle neumí, prozatím).

TIP: Jak udělat pořádek v záložkách (oblíbených) v prohlížeči?

Bookmarklety fungují i na mobilních telefonech (tedy v mobilních prohlížečích) – tam to nepůjde pomocí Drag&Drop ale klasicky pomocí založení Oblíbené položky a kopírování javascriptu.

Bookmarklety se dají snadno najít na Internetu. Viz například Bookmarklets či 100+ Useful Bookmarklets For Better Productivity | Ultimate List.

POZNÁMKA: Pokud nevíte zda určitý bookmarklet není škodlivý, tak ho spíš nezkoušejte používat. Každopádně škodlivý Javascript může spustit jakákoliv webová stránka, může se objevit i v inzertních pozicích.

Reklamy